Kuteh Kumeh (Persian: كوته كومه, also Romanized as ‘’’Kūteh Kūmeh’’’)[1] is a village in the suburbs of Lavandevil District, Astara County, Gilan Province, Iran. At the 2016 census, its population was 581, in 177 families,[2] Decreased from 906 people in 2006. The language of the residents of this region which are mostly Sunni Muslims (Shafi‘i denomination) is Taleshi. The village is located 9 kilometers from Lavandevil. The most attractive points of interest of Kuteh Kumeh are Latun (Barzov) waterfall and Gamo hot water spring.
